Characteristics of heat-resistant steel precision castings:
Heat-resistant steel precision castings should be stacked reasonably according to the layout characteristics during heat treatment to prevent deformation as much as possible. When the as-cast arrangement segregation of the casting is serious, in order to eliminate the influence on the function of the end of the casting, it is necessary to adopt a unified treatment method. In the as-cast arrangement, there are often coarse dendrites and segregation.
During heat treatment, the heating temperature should be slightly higher than that of forged steel parts with the same composition, and the austenitizing holding time should be extended appropriately. For steel castings with complex shapes and large wall thickness, the cross-sectional effect and casting need to be considered during heat treatment.

How to clean heat-resistant steel precision castings:
Heat-resistant steel precision casting is a kind of casting. The cleaning of heat-resistant steel precision castings is divided into general cleaning, ultrasonic cleaning, degreasing cleaning and vacuum cleaning. They have their own characteristics, and the formulas of the cleaning solutions they use are different. Generally, cleaning agents include solvent-based cleaning solutions and water-based cleaning solutions.
In the actual cleaning process of heat-resistant steel precision castings, the most used ones are:
1. Metal cleaning agent
Mostly used for cleaning heat-resistant steel precision castings before heat treatment and chemical heat treatment
2. 3%-10% sodium carbonate or sodium hydrogen hydride cleaning solution, the temperature is controlled at 80-100°C, and it is mostly used for degreasing and salt slag finishing of heat-resistant steel precision castings after quenching.
